PERRY-Bonnie Alice Nesbitt Chisholm, 83, passed away on Tuesday, July 4, 2017. Visitation will be on Friday, July 7, 2017, from 6:00 until 8:00 p.m. at Watson-Hunt Funeral Home. Funeral Services will be held on Saturday, July 8, 2017, at 11:00 a.m. in the Chapel at Watson-Hunt Funeral Home. Interment will be in Perry Memorial Gardens immediately following the service. In lieu of flowers, the family respectfully requests memorial contributions to Morningside Elementary School Relay For Life Team, 1206 Morningside Drive, Perry, GA 31069.Ms. Chisholm was born in and grew up in New Mexico. She had lived in Perry for the last 3 years, moving to be closer to her daughter. She was an avid reader all of her life. She thoroughly enjoyed playing Bingo, and some lovingly referred to her as "Bingo Nut". She was a huge fan of the Atlanta Braves and Dallas Cowboys. Bonnie was a member of The Church of Jesus Christ of Latter-Day Saints. She was preceded in death by her parents, 4 brothers, 3 sisters, and her daughter, Cosetta Rogers.Survivors include her children, Deantha Grattan (Larry), Greg Chisholm, and Holly Buckley (Johnathan); 9 grandchildren; 11 great-grandchildren; her brothers, Bud Nesbitt (Mary), Tom Nesbitt (Marie), and Tim Nesbitt (Plyna); and numerous nieces and nephews.Please sign the online guestbook at www.watsonhunt.com.
